Data Flow Components

Exploring the essential Data Flow Components in SSIS 816 reveals the core building blocks that enable seamless data movement and transformation within your integration processes. The data flow architecture in SSIS involves a series of components that work together in a pipeline processing fashion to manipulate data efficiently. Here are four key components to understand:

  • Source Component: This initiates the data flow by extracting information from a source, such as a database, Excel file, or API.
  • Transformation Component: These components modify the extracted data in various ways, like sorting, aggregating, or converting formats.
  • Destination Component: Responsible for loading the transformed data into the target destination, which could be a database, file, or cloud service.
  • Data Flow Path: Connects the components, establishing the flow of data from the source through transformations to the destination.

Mastering these components is vital for designing effective data integration solutions in SSIS 816.

Control Flow Tasks

In SSIS 816, Control Flow Tasks play a pivotal role in orchestrating the sequence of operations within integration processes, ensuring smooth execution of tasks. Task sequencing is a fundamental aspect of Control Flow Tasks, enabling developers to define the order in which tasks are executed. This feature allows for the creation of structured workflows, ensuring that each task is performed in the correct sequence to achieve the desired outcome efficiently.

Conditional branching is another critical capability offered by Control Flow Tasks. It allows developers to create logical conditions that determine the path the control flow should follow based on specified criteria. This branching mechanism adds flexibility to integration processes, enabling the implementation of complex business logic and decision-making within the workflow.
